Curious Kids Cooking and Food Science Camp

| 20 Bell Road, Greenville, SC

Interactive STEAM cooking and food science camp for children rising 1st grade – 6th grade.

Camps are from 9 am – 12 pm, 4 days long.

WEEK 1 (Rising 1st-3rd Grade): June 10th-13th
WEEK 2 (Rising 2nd-4th Grade): June 17th-20th
WEEK 3 (Rising 4th-6th Grade): June 24th-27th

Good to Go Greenville

864.283.0347 | 209 West Antrim Drive, Greenville, SC

Offers: Cooking camp for beginners! Children will learn basic kitchen skills, baking 101, strengthen motor skills, and promote diverse eating habits.
Ages: 6 – 12 years old
Cost: $375 per week
The classes will include a snack, apron, and recipe book
June and July camps available

Summer camps will run from 9:30 AM to 12:30 PM
